Different Types of Android Car Screens

The available options for Android car screens vary significantly in size and capabilities. Single-DIN units are compact, fitting into standard single-DIN car stereo slots. Double-DIN units offer more space and screen real estate, while head-unit replacements completely replace the existing car stereo, providing a more integrated experience.

Common Issues and Solutions

A variety of issues can arise with Android car screens, from minor display glitches to complete system failures. Understanding the typical causes allows you to address these effectively. Common issues include unresponsive touchscreens, flickering displays, audio problems, and connectivity issues. Each issue has potential causes and effective solutions.

  • Unresponsive Touchscreen: A common issue is a malfunctioning touchscreen. This can stem from a number of causes, such as software glitches, physical damage, or even a faulty cable connection. First, try restarting the system. If that doesn’t work, check for physical obstructions or damage to the screen. Consider updating the operating system to the latest version.

    If the problem persists, consider a professional diagnosis to identify the root cause.

  • Flickering Display: A flickering display often indicates an issue with the screen’s backlight or power supply. First, check for any physical damage to the screen. Restarting the system and updating the software can often resolve minor issues. If the problem persists, consider contacting a qualified technician for diagnosis and repair.
  • Audio Problems: Audio issues can stem from a range of problems, including corrupted audio files, faulty connections, or software glitches. Verify the audio source is set correctly and the volume is not muted. If the problem persists, updating the software or the audio application might resolve the issue. Check the connections between the audio components. If the problem continues, consult a professional.

  • Connectivity Issues: Connectivity problems, such as poor Bluetooth or Wi-Fi reception, can hinder the system’s ability to connect to external devices. Try restarting the system and check for any physical obstructions. Ensure the Bluetooth or Wi-Fi connections are properly established. Verify that the necessary protocols are set correctly on the external devices. If the problem persists, consult a technician for a diagnosis.

Maintenance Procedures

Routine maintenance is critical to extending the lifespan of your Android car screen and preventing major issues. Regular cleaning, proper handling, and protection from damage are key to optimal performance.

  • Cleaning: Use a soft, lint-free cloth to clean the screen, avoiding harsh chemicals or abrasive materials. Wipe gently in a circular motion to remove dust and debris.
  • Handling: Avoid dropping or impacting the screen, as this can cause physical damage. Be mindful when installing or removing accessories to prevent accidental damage.
  • Protection: Consider using a screen protector to provide an extra layer of protection against scratches and impacts. Protect the screen from direct sunlight and extreme temperatures.
